RICS Victoria are pleased to invite you to the APC Surgery and networking evening in Melbourne: 2 Hours Formal CPD
Join us for an insightful RICS APC Surgery designed to guide APC candidates and students on their journey towards becoming chartered surveyors. This event offers practical advice, clarity on the pathway, and inspiration for anyone on this professional path.
What You’ll Gain:
- Expert insights on the APC process and the steps to achieve chartered status.
- Guidance for students on navigating the pathway to becoming a chartered surveyor after graduation.
- Inspiration and practical advice for those dedicated to pursuing this respected profession.
Who Should Attend:
- APC candidates preparing for their final assessment.
- Students interested in pursuing a career as a chartered surveyor.
- Industry peers considering the APC route to chartered status.
- Existing MRICS members – your experience and insights are invaluable. Join us to share your journey and inspire the next generation of chartered surveyors.
Event Highlights:
1. Keynote Presentation by Joshua Haswell, RICS APC Expert:
- Detailed breakdown of the APC pathway.
- Comprehensive overview of the APC process.
- Timeline and milestones leading to the final assessment.
- The benefits of becoming a chartered surveyor.
- Transitioning from student to chartered surveyor – the steps involved.
2. Panel Discussion:
- Hear from a diverse panel of RICS professional members who have successfully navigated different APC pathways.
- Gain insights into the common challenges faced during the APC process.
- Learn valuable tips and strategies to overcome difficulties and excel in your APC journey.
3. Final Assessment Interview – Q&A Demonstration:
- Watch a live demonstration of a final assessment interview.
- Understand common mistakes made by candidates and learn what to avoid.
- Get your questions answered by industry experts to ensure you're fully prepared.
